Curiosidades sobre la música How 'Bout Them Cowgirls del George Strait

¿Cuándo fue lanzada la canción “How 'Bout Them Cowgirls” por George Strait?
La canción How 'Bout Them Cowgirls fue lanzada en 2006, en el álbum “It Just Comes Natural”.
¿Quién compuso la canción “How 'Bout Them Cowgirls” de George Strait?
La canción “How 'Bout Them Cowgirls” de George Strait fue compuesta por Casey Beathard y Ed Hill.
